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0586604 25621470 7943644 34856296988 070495
5208961621 8850 150
5208961621 8850 150
734 6848284 606
All about undefined
Interested in learning more?
5208961621 8850 150
734 6848284 606
See more
72860617704 28 329404
271 95318 81094281
See more
487554164 923706 87461
694 3566407888 090519975 66805374 28702
See more